Situated on the popular residential road Georgelands in Ripley, this semi-detached home presents a wonderful opportunity to create a truly bespoke family house. The property offers tremendous scope to extend and modernise (STPP), all while enjoying breathtaking countryside views to the rear.
A front porch provides one of two access points into the home, with a further side entrance conveniently located next to the driveway. From the porch, a door opens into the entrance hallway which gives access to all the principal living rooms, setting the tone for a well-balanced and practical layout. The family room features an open fireplace, enhanced by sliding patio doors that open directly onto a rear garden patio — perfect for relaxing while enjoying the outlook. The larger sitting room benefits from built-in storage and a charming bay window that frames views over the garden and the unspoilt countryside beyond, filling the space with natural light. The bright galley kitchen offers a generous range of fitted units, while a step down leads into a versatile utility/dining area. Here you’ll find additional storage, a WC and an external door that provides easy side access to the property — ideal for busy family life. Upstairs there are three double bedrooms, all with built-in storage and the family bathroom.
Outside, the property to the front there is parking for several vehicles, and the open-ended driveway that allows direct access through to the rear garden. The garden itself is mainly laid to lawn and features a patio area, two large sheds for storage, and a pathway leading to a further seating area at the far end. From here, you can truly appreciate the peaceful, far-reaching views across the surrounding countryside — a rare and special feature that sets this home apart.
With its enviable location, generous plot and huge potential for enhancement, this is a wonderful opportunity to secure a long-term family home in one of Ripley’s most sought-after roads.
Georgelands is a popular residential road situated in Ripley village and within close walking distance to the local shops, pubs and the coveted village green. The nearby village of Send is close to open countryside which is ideal for walking and outdoor pursuits. The centre offers some local shops for one’s day-to-day needs as well as a recreation ground, a newly built medical centre and pharmacy and two pubs one of which is situated on the Wey Navigation Canal.
Woking Station offers regular service to London Waterloo with trains about every 7 minutes and a journey time of around 22 minutes. Alternative services are provided from West Clandon with trains to London Waterloo arriving within one hour. The area has excellent road and rail connections with the A3 and Junction 10 of the M25 being within close proximity.

The first Seymours Estate Agents opened here in Ripley in 1992, and after twenty-five years continues to be one of, if not the, largest independent estate agent in the West Surrey area totalling a strategic network of 17 offices. We focus on Ripley and its surrounding villages, West Clandon, East Clandon, Send, Send Marsh, Ockham and West Horsley. These beautifully picturesque Surrey villages are incredibly popular with all walks of life, families, young professionals and downsizers. The village of Ripley is said to have the largest village green in England (approximately sixty five acres) and benefits from a selection of award-winning cafés, shops, pubs and a Michelin star restaurant. Ripley enjoys superb access to both the A3 and M25 keeping this ever-popular village well-connected and in demand.
